Hello everyone! Hope you are all doing well. I have an automator workflow designed to open several applications. I want to run it automatically when I log in to my account. Any way to do it without having automator open?

OS X Leopard 10.5.6
Automator 2.0.2

I don't use Automator but this should work.

Open Automator, create your workflow and save it as an application, not a workflow (look under "File Format:" in the save dialog). Now, make this application a login item for your user. To do that, go to System Preferences > Accounts > select your user name > Login Items > click the + button to add it.

You may also be able to check the box to hide it but I'm not sure if that will work.
